WebSummary . When the apostles read the Old Testament, they saw references to Christ and his kingdom, as it were, on every page. Jesus is the second Adam, the perfect law keeper, the scion of David who would sit on David’s throne forever, the ultimate singer of the psalms, the wisdom of God, the suffering servant, the perfect high priest, to name just a few. And now there is no need for further offerings and sacrifices. The … WebEarly Christian symbols Elemental symbols. Elemental symbols were often used by the early Church. Water is an important symbol to Christians. Water is symbolic in baptism.It may also mean cleansing or purity. Fire symbolizes both the Holy Spirit and light. It is often used in the form of a candle flame.The sources of these symbols comes from the Bible.

WebFeb 23, 2005 · 1. The blood sacrifices ceased because Christ fulfilled all that they were pointing toward. He was the final, unrepeatable sacrifice for sins. Hebrews 9:12, “He entered once for all into the holy places, not by means of the blood of goats and calves but by means of his own blood, thus securing an eternal redemption.”.
